untitled

The way you leave
after all we've done
Like Cinderella on the night when
midnight meant disaster
Leaves me gasping and grasping
clutching handfuls of emptiness
Emotions eating at me
Your fading kisses burning
On my lips the
Smell of your hair fast leaving my breath
I can still feel your warmth
Though it seeps through my palms like light
Fleeing from darkness
I can still remember you say "I love..."

Wait.

Wait for it.
For the rush... Almost there...
Harder
Faster

"You."

Game. Set. And match.
